HS Code 0804

Dates, Figs, Coconuts and Other Tropical Fruits

HS Code 0804 covers dates, figs, coconuts (copra), and other tropical fruits, fresh or dried. This includes fresh coconuts, dried coconuts, copra, and products derived from these tropical fruits.

HS Code Structure

08 = Edible fruit and nuts; 0804 = Dates, figs, coconuts and other tropical fruits

Required Certifications

  • Phytosanitary Certificate
  • Certificate of Origin
  • Fumigation Certificate
  • Moisture Content Certificate
  • Halal Certificate (for certain markets)

Import Regulations

EU Import Regulations

Coconuts and tropical fruits imported into the EU must comply with Regulation (EC) No 396/2005 on pesticide residues. Products must meet phytosanitary requirements under Directive 2000/29/EC. Some products may require import permits.

Quality Standards

EU quality standards for coconuts specify moisture content, size, and absence of mold or pests. Copra (dried coconut kernel) must meet minimum oil content standards. Products are graded by size, weight, and appearance.

US FDA Requirements

Coconuts and tropical fruits imported into the US must comply with FDA food safety regulations. Products must be free from pests and diseases. FDA enforces standards for pesticide residues and food additives.
